Understanding BMW Keys

Before diving into the replacement procedure, it's vital to understand the types of keys utilized for BMW automobiles. BMW keys differ based on the model and year of manufacture. The most typical types include:

Key TypeDescription
Traditional KeyA traditional metal key that opens the door and begins the ignition.
Transponder KeyGeared up with a chip that interacts with the vehicle's ignition system to allow starting, improving security.
Smart KeyA keyless entry system that enables the motorist to unlock, start, and gain access to the car without physically placing the key.
Remote Key FobA key that consists of buttons for locking and unlocking the doors, with or without a standard key integrated.

The Key Replacement Process

The key replacement process for BMW lorries usually includes the following steps:

  1. Identification: The provider will require proof of ownership, such as a vehicle registration or title, and identification to start the process.

  2. Key Cutting: If a conventional key is needed, the specialist will cut a new key utilizing a key cutting machine based upon the supplied key code.

  3. Shows: For transponder and wise keys, the key should be configured to synchronize with the vehicle's security system. This typically involves connecting to the onboard computer system utilizing specialized software application.

  4. Checking: After shows, the professional will check the new key to make sure all functions, including unlocking, beginning, and any remote functions, work correctly.

  5. Settling Payment: Once whatever is confirmed to be working correctly, the payment will typically be processed.

Approximated Costs

When considering key replacement for BMW vehicles, comprehending the expenses included can help in budgeting. Below is a basic approximated cost table:

Key TypeCost RangeTime Required
Traditional Key₤ 50 - ₤ 10030 - 60 minutes
Transponder Key₤ 100 - ₤ 3001 - 2 hours
Smart Key₤ 300 - ₤ 5001 - 3 hours
Remote Key Fob₤ 100 - ₤ 3001 - 2 hours

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q: Can I replace my BMW key myself?

A: While it may be appealing to try DIY methods, it is highly advised to look for professional services for BMW key replacement due to the technical requirements associated with programming.

Q: How long does it require to get a new key?

A: Depending on the key type and the company, the procedure can take anywhere from 30 minutes to a couple of hours.

Q: What if I have lost my key and do not have a spare?

A: In this case, contacting a BMW car dealership or a specialized locksmith is important. They can develop a new key based upon your car's VIN, although this may require extra identification and evidence of ownership.

Q: Will my car be debilitated if I lose my key?

A: Depending on the design, a lot of BMWs have security systems that prevent the engine from beginning. Thus, it's vital to replace lost keys immediately.

Q: Are there any security worry about key replacement?

A: Yes, if you have lost a key, it's a good idea to replace the key and reset the lorry's security system to avoid unapproved access.
